Piggyback loans may be tougher to refinance later. Just before refinancing, the 2nd home loan would need to become paid off or subordinated. To subordinate the 2nd mortgage loan, the refinance lender would want to comply with make their loan second in importance behind The brand new very first house loan. In some instances, this agreement is usually not easy to get, making refinancing more difficult.

Borrowers who help save more on the main loan than they shell out on the second loan reap the benefits of piggybacking. Execs of a piggyback home finance loan:
You could bridge a pending property sale cash hole. An eighty-10-10 loan will let you temporarily deal with the down payment on a whole new home in case you’re still looking to provide your existing household. Even better: You need to use the gains from your property sale to pay back the 2nd home loan with no refinancing.
